The return of the ship "Shenzhou-20" to Earth was postponed
The return of the Chinese Shenzhou-20 spacecraft to Earth was postponed due to a collision of the aircraft, presumably with small space debris. This was reported on November 5 by China Central Television (CCTV).
"To ensure the safety and health of astronauts, as well as the full success of the mission, it was decided to postpone the Shenzhou-20 mission, originally scheduled for November 5," the publication says.
It is specified that a collision check and risk assessment are currently underway.
China Central Television reported on April 24 that China had launched the Shenzhou-20 spacecraft with three taikonauts into space. The crew consisted of taikonauts Chen Dong (commander), Chen Zhongrui and Wang Jie. The team will work in the orbital laboratory until October.
